Vulnerability details

Vul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form Cross-site scripting attacks.

An input validation error exists in import.php in phpMyAdmin before 4.1.7. A remote authenticated attacker can trick the victim to follow a specially crafted link and execute arbitrary HTML and script code in victim's browser in security context of vulnerable website.

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may allow a remote attacker to steal potentially sensitive information, change appearance of the web page, perform phishing and drive-by-download attacks.

How to mitigate CVE-2014-1879

Update to version 4.1.7.

phpMyAdmin - update to 4.1.7
phpmyadmin (Alpine package) - update to 3.4.11.1-r1
phpMyAdmin - update to 4.0.10.1-1.el6
phpMyAdmin4 - update to 4.0.10.3-2.el5
